

Siddharth's profile and their contact details have been verified by our experts
Siddharth
- Rate $9
- Response 9h
-
Students3
Number of students Siddharth has taught since their arrival at Superprof
Number of students Siddharth has taught since their arrival at Superprof

$9/h
Unfortunately, this tutor is unavailable
- Computer programming
- Python
- C
- Computer languages
- Java
Want to learn computer programming form an industry professional ? I am an incoming Masters student at Arizona State University and have two years of professional experience in Data Science and Softwa
- Computer programming
- Python
- C
- Computer languages
- Java
Lesson location
- online
-
at your home or a public place : will travel up to 20 mi. from Phoenix
Recommended
Siddharth is a respected tutor in our community. They have been highly recommended for their commitment and the quality of their lessons — an excellent choice to progress with confidence.
About Siddharth
I am an incoming Masters student in Computer Science at the Arizona State University. Currently, I am working as a data science consultant at DBT/Wellcome Trust India Alliance where my work involves figuring out biases in funding and grant processes. This was implemented in python with support from standard mathematical libraries.
Earlier, I worked as a software engineer at Cvent where I developed 2-Factor Authentication for the main Cvent login page. Here, I worked on Java(Dropwizard framework) and React with Redux.
I actively practise Data Structures and Algorithms in Java as I prepare for software engineering interviews in the coming months.
I have taken several workshops on version control and dynamic programming in my college where I also cofounded the ACM student chapter.
I know it might be a tough call to decide, so hit me up and let's talk on your specific needs and what I can offer to suit you best.
About the lesson
- All Levels
- English
All languages in which the lesson is available :
English
Programming is best learnt by doing. So, it will be a righteous mix of code and theory afterwards. I liked the approach in a fast.ai course by Prof. Jeremy Howard and will seek to implement a similar approach.
1. For each lesson we will first implement code for the topic and then go over the theory. Firstly, one does not get bored(which is very important) with this and secondly, the context of the theory is much better after this.
2. We will regularly practise at Leetcode, Hackerearth and InterviewBit to enhance our experience.
3. The exact content can be shaped by what all is already known to you and what all I can best offer.
Let's talk it out and schedule a free class to see if you like the course!
Recommendations
Recommendations come from relatives, friends and acquaintances of the teacher
Exceptional teaching abilities to improve the technical concepts of the students. I myself studied and performed better when it comes to Java. I’m confident he’ll continue to produce such results. I have no reservations giving Siddharth, my highest recommendation for Java.I know Siddharth from college. Being from a non CS background, he was the go to person for me. I love the way he teaches, taking examples with an attempt to convey a thorough understanding of the language. You will get a 'feel' as to why some concept came into picture or why some functionality is provided by the language. He is so in touch with the community that he generally knows why a change has been made to any of the libraries/language and what are the implications. I would trust him if I had to learn all over again.
I have taken Java lessons and data structures lessons from Siddharth. He is very proficient in java programming skills and has in depth knowledge about his subject. He has a very unique and engaging way of teaching and every topics seems to be so easy. He knows how to break the complex problems into small parts and how to quickly approach. Most recommended. With him programming is fun....
I know Siddharth from college days, he and I collaborated on various projects, he helped me develop App and website for my business. One thing I can say confidently about him is that he is a highly skilled programmer with proficiency in many language especially java.
I reached out to Siddharth when I was struggling to cope with my coding course on JAVA, and it has been the best decision that I ever took.
Siddharth is a wonderful teacher! He has the perfect teaching method that make it very easy to grasp new concepts. During the class he also shared practice exercises that were really helpful and helped build my concepts.
He is a great teacher and I would highly recommend you to choose Siddharth as your tutor.View more recommendations
Rates
Rate
- $9
Pack rates
- 5h: $45
- 10h: $90
online
- $9/h
Other tutors in Computer programming
Kenny
Phoenix & online
- $20/h
- 1st lesson free
Maya
Phoenix & online
- $25/h
- 1st lesson free
Shreya
Phoenix & online
- $35/h
- 1st lesson free
Omar
Phoenix & online
- $40/h
- 1st lesson free
Ayesha
Scottsdale & online
- $33/h
- 1st lesson free
Piper
Scottsdale & online
- $39/h
- 1st lesson free
Oliver
Scottsdale & online
- $39/h
- 1st lesson free
Myra
Scottsdale & online
- $35/h
- 1st lesson free
Harriet
Tempe & online
- $42/h
- 1st lesson free
Muawia
Goodyear & online
- $13/h
- 1st lesson free
Alex
Mesa & online
- $50/h
- 1st lesson free
Esmaeil
New York & online
- $30/h
- 1st lesson free
Michael
New York & online
- $50/h
- 1st lesson free
Reza
Brooklyn & online
- $75/h
Gabriel
Seattle & online
- $25/h
Mehrdad
New York & online
- $30/h
- 1st lesson free
Ricardo
San Antonio & online
- $25/h
Nicholas
Los Angeles & online
- $50/h
- 1st lesson free
Blake
Crystal Lake & online
- $28/h
- 1st lesson free
João
New York & online
- $25/h
-
See Computer programming tutors